Forum » Programiranje » [I guess solved...][SQL] Kako napisati preprost GROUP BY?
[I guess solved...][SQL] Kako napisati preprost GROUP BY?
HotBurek ::
Dobro jutro.
Evo, nov dan, nov izziv.
Tabela ima sledeče podatke:
Vprašanje pa je, kako napisati SELECT ... GROUP BY, da bo rezultat vrnil:
--------------------------------------------------------------
UPDATE
Zgleda sem kar hitro rešil:
Vseeno pa v preverbo, če je to to. Oz. če so še kakšne druge, mogoče boljše opcije.
Evo, nov dan, nov izziv.
Tabela ima sledeče podatke:
group1|name1 | ------+-------+ 0|krompir| 0|krompir| 0|krompir| 0|japke | 1|japke |
Vprašanje pa je, kako napisati SELECT ... GROUP BY, da bo rezultat vrnil:
count|name1 | -----+-------+ 2|japke | 1|krompir|
--------------------------------------------------------------
UPDATE
Zgleda sem kar hitro rešil:
SELECT COUNT(DISTINCT(`group1`)) AS 'count', `name1` FROM `test1` GROUP BY `name1`;
Vseeno pa v preverbo, če je to to. Oz. če so še kakšne druge, mogoče boljše opcije.
root@debian:/# iptraf-ng
fatal: This program requires a screen size of at least 80 columns by 24 lines
Please resize your window
fatal: This program requires a screen size of at least 80 columns by 24 lines
Please resize your window
Vredno ogleda ...
Tema | Ogledi | Zadnje sporočilo | |
---|---|---|---|
Tema | Ogledi | Zadnje sporočilo | |
» | Kako napisat SQL query?Oddelek: Programiranje | 1300 (506) | HotBurek |
» | Učenje programiranja PHPOddelek: Programiranje | 1484 (1025) | Spura |
» | SQL poizvedbaOddelek: Programiranje | 622 (572) | frudi |
» | postgreSQL pomočOddelek: Programiranje | 2042 (1377) | klemenSLO |
» | MySQL pomocOddelek: Izdelava spletišč | 1847 (1103) | slosi |